Security is naturally the primary concern for any individual considering moving their personal belongings into an external facility. When exploring options for Birmingham storage, residents should look for features that go beyond a simple lock and key. Modern facilities are now designed with multiple layers of protection that act as a deterrent to unauthorised access while providing peace of mind to the user. This typically includes high-definition CCTV surveillance that monitors all entry points and corridors around the clock, sophisticated alarm systems that are individually linked to each unit, and perimeter fencing that creates a secure boundary. Furthermore, the presence of on-site staff during business hours adds a human element of vigilance that automated systems alone cannot provide. For a local resident, knowing that their sentimental heirlooms or expensive sporting equipment are under constant watch allows them to treat the storage unit as a seamless extension of their own home security.

The environment within the unit itself is just as important as the security surrounding it. The British weather can be notoriously unpredictable, and fluctuations in temperature or humidity can wreak havoc on sensitive materials. When selecting a site for Birmingham storage, it is wise to consider the benefits of climate control. This technology ensures that the internal temperature remains stable and that moisture levels are kept in check, which is crucial for protecting items such as antique wooden furniture, delicate fabrics, and important paper documents. Without these protections, items can be subject to warping, mould growth, or dampness, which can cause irreparable damage over a long period. By opting for a facility that prioritises a clean and dry environment, residents are making an investment in the longevity of their possessions.

For those in the midst of a relocation, the logistical support offered by a storage provider can be a life-saver. Moving house is frequently cited as one of the most stressful life events, often because of the pressure to move everything in a single day. Utilising Birmingham storage as a temporary staging post allows for a much more phased and manageable transition. By moving non-essential items into storage weeks before the big move, the final day becomes significantly less cluttered and chaotic. It also provides a useful buffer if there are delays in a property chain, ensuring that belongings are safe and out of the way until the new home is ready to receive them. Many sites even offer on-site shops selling high-quality packing materials, ensuring that residents have everything they need to protect their goods from the moment they leave their front door.
